ski carrying backpack

A ski carrying backpack represents a specialized piece of outdoor equipment designed to revolutionize the way winter sports enthusiasts transport their gear. These innovative backpacks feature dedicated straps and compartments specifically engineered to secure skis while maintaining optimal weight distribution and comfort during transport. The primary structure incorporates reinforced diagonal or A-frame carrying systems, allowing for secure ski attachment without compromising the backpack's stability or the wearer's mobility. Modern ski carrying backpacks typically include weatherproof materials, ensuring your gear stays protected from snow and moisture. The interior compartments are thoughtfully organized with separate spaces for avalanche safety equipment, extra layers, and personal items. Advanced models feature ergonomic back panels with ventilation channels, padded shoulder straps, and adjustable sternum and hip belts for maximum comfort during extended wear. Many designs also incorporate quick-access pockets for essential items, hydration system compatibility, and attachment points for additional gear like ice axes or hiking poles. These backpacks often include compression straps to maintain a compact profile when fully loaded, making them ideal for both backcountry adventures and resort skiing.

The ski carrying backpack offers numerous practical advantages that make it an essential piece of equipment for any serious skier. First and foremost, it provides hands-free transportation of skis, allowing users to navigate terrain, use hiking poles, or manage other gear with greater ease. The specialized design distributes weight evenly across the back and hips, reducing fatigue during long approaches or descents. Unlike traditional methods of carrying skis, these backpacks minimize the risk of damage to both the equipment and surrounding objects while providing better balance and stability. The weatherproof construction ensures that stored gear remains dry and protected, while multiple access points allow for quick retrieval of essential items without the need to completely unpack. The versatility of these backpacks extends beyond ski carrying capabilities, as they can be used as regular daypacks when not transporting skis. The ergonomic design features promote proper posture and reduce strain during extended use, while adjustable components ensure a customized fit for different body types and preferences. Additionally, the organized compartment system helps users maintain their gear in an orderly fashion, improving efficiency and accessibility during activities. The inclusion of safety features such as whistle buckles and reflective elements enhances visibility and emergency preparedness. Many models also incorporate specialized pockets for avalanche safety gear, making them ideal for backcountry expeditions.

Advanced Carrying System Design

Advanced Carrying System Design

The ski carrying backpack's advanced carrying system represents a significant evolution in winter sports equipment transport. The system typically features reinforced attachment points and multiple carrying configurations, including diagonal and A-frame options, allowing users to choose the most comfortable and efficient method for their specific needs. The straps are strategically positioned to maintain the skis close to the user's center of gravity, reducing sway and improving balance during movement. High-strength buckles and compression straps ensure that skis remain securely fastened even during demanding activities, while quick-release mechanisms allow for rapid deployment when needed. The system's versatility accommodates various ski widths and lengths, making it suitable for different skiing disciplines and equipment preferences.
Weather-Resistant Protection

Weather-Resistant Protection

The weather-resistant features of ski carrying backpacks provide crucial protection for valuable equipment and personal items in harsh winter conditions. The exterior is constructed from high-density, water-resistant materials that effectively repel snow, sleet, and rain while maintaining durability against abrasion and tears. Strategic seam sealing and waterproof zippers prevent moisture from penetrating the pack's interior, ensuring that sensitive items remain dry throughout the day. The base of the pack often incorporates additional reinforcement and water-resistant properties to protect against wet snow and ground contact. This comprehensive weather protection system extends the lifespan of both the backpack and its contents while providing peace of mind during variable weather conditions.
Ergonomic Comfort Features

Ergonomic Comfort Features

The ergonomic design elements of ski carrying backpacks prioritize user comfort during extended periods of use. The back panel features contoured padding with strategic ventilation channels that promote airflow and reduce heat buildup, while maintaining close contact with the user's back for optimal load control. Shoulder straps incorporate multi-density foam padding that distributes pressure evenly and prevents pressure points, even when carrying heavy loads. The adjustable sternum strap and padded hip belt work in concert to transfer weight to the user's hips, reducing shoulder strain and improving overall stability. Load lifter straps allow for fine-tuning of the pack's position, ensuring that the weight remains properly balanced regardless of the terrain or activity level.
